Educational Opportunities

If you require additional occupational skills to obtain employment, funding may be available to attend school at one of our eligible training providers in a career that is in demand. But, since we operate under a Work-First concept, when someone seeks assistance through one of our Career Centers we first determine if that individual has relevant, marketable work skills and is ready to enter or advance in the job market.

Because each job seeker’s personal and financial situation is unique, we recommend you contact the center nearest you to make an appointment with a Career Development Professional.
Tuition assistance may be available for occupational skills upgrade.
